Basic Concepts of Lock Nuts
Lock nuts are mechanical fasteners that prevent loosening due to vibration or rotation. They function by creating a frictional force between the nut and the threaded component, which resists movement 1. In heavy-duty applications, such as commercial trucks, secure fastening is vital to ensure the reliability and safety of the vehicle. Lock nuts play a significant role in maintaining the structural integrity of assemblies under dynamic conditions 2.

Troubleshooting and Maintenance
Common issues with lock nuts may include loosening due to wear or damage, and corrosion in exposed environments. Troubleshooting involves inspecting the lock nut for signs of wear, ensuring proper torque during installation, and replacing damaged units. Regular maintenance practices, such as checking for proper tightness and protecting against corrosion, are essential to ensure the optimal performance and longevity of the Cummins 3645029 Lock Nut 6.
